Transaction 706f4955ee0aaeb45d02c904f04210b75dbe779d3e681dcb481489c4d651303f

1 Input
2 Outputs
  • 706f4955ee0aaeb45d02c904f04210b75dbe779d3e681dcb481489c4d651303f:0
  • value  343346
    address  3FM1BwH1qsXRVtBRRfoAxQV3bTr4nARUJt
  • 706f4955ee0aaeb45d02c904f04210b75dbe779d3e681dcb481489c4d651303f:1
  • value  2356699
    address  3A7e4xJjf3mA3AeFE4gUhDLodSMcHCgEkT